Output 43411626ac9feb4bac580fcb39861d6621ba1be6087ab2eb5e0b73fa0af8e153:1

value
990625
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a333c81fa94dfff7e7017abf2f4fbeb75acf63a7 OP_EQUAL
address
3GZx6fp9Qe8qAkFaMomYuqQQFapFKcfGm9
transaction
43411626ac9feb4bac580fcb39861d6621ba1be6087ab2eb5e0b73fa0af8e153
spent
true